What is a Typical Water Bottle Size?
A standard water bottle holds between 16 to 32 fluid ounces, but most commonly, bottles come in these popular sizes:
- 16 ounces (about 473 mL) – Lightweight and ideal for regular sips during the day. Good for daytime hydration without feeling bulky.
- 20 ounces (about 591 mL) – A popular mid-size that offers ample hydration for office use or light exercise.
- 32 ounces (about 946 mL) – Perfect for prolonged physical activity, hiking, or extended workdays when access to sink water is limited.

Some bottles also range up to 64 ounces (2 liters), which suits athletes, frequent travelers, or anyone needing a large reserve.
How Many Ounces Is Ideal Based on Your Lifestyle?
Choosing the right ounce size depends on your daily routine and health goals. Here’s a guide to help you decide:
| Activity Level | Recommended Ounces | Why? |
|--------------------------|------------------------|------------------------------------------|
| Office worker / daily use | 16–32 oz | Easy to carry, fits most cup holders |
| Active lifestyle | 32–64 oz | Sustains energy during workouts |
| Outdoor adventures | 48–64 oz | Keeps you hydrated on extended hikes |
| Athletes / runners | 32–64 oz (plus beyond) | Supports heavy perspiration and recovery |
| Children | 8–16 oz | Lightweight and age-appropriate |

Benefits of Choosing the Right Ounage
- Better hydration habits: A bottle sized for your lifestyle encourages regular sipping, reducing the risk of dehydration.
- Convenience: Lighter, smaller bottles ease travel and long outings, while larger sizes reduce frequent refills.
- Portion control: Clear measurements in ounces help track daily intake, aiding goals like the widely recommended 8x8 rule (8 glasses, 8 oz each).
Choosing the Right Material & Size
- Stainless steel bottles typically range from 25 oz to 64 oz, offering durability and insulation.
- Plastic bottles often come in classic 20–32 oz; look for BPA-free options.
- Collapsible bottles offer flexible capacity, ideal for backpackers and travelers.
